#216f94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#216f94 is composed of 12.9% red, 43.5%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.7% cyan, 25%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 199.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 35.5%. #216f94 color hex could be obtained by blending #42deff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#216f94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#216f94 has RGB values of R:33, G:111,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2191252.

Shades and Tints of #216f94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010304 is the darkest color, while #f3f9fc is the lightest one.
